ABSTRACT

Triangular QRS-ST-T waveform electrocardiography pattern, so-called "shark fin sign," is a rare and highly mortal electrocardiography finding, which usually occurs in adult patients with coronary occlusion. Here, we reported the first paediatric case occurring in a striking "triangular waveform electrocardiography pattern" due to myocarditis during COVID-19 infection.

ABSTRACT

Introduction There have been some significant changes regarding healthcare utilization during the COVID-19 pandemic. Majority of the reports about the impact of the COVID-19 pandemic on diabetes care are from the first wave of the pandemic. We aim to evaluate the potential effects of the COVID-19 pandemic on the severity of diabetic ketoacidosis (DKA) and new onset Type 1 diabetes presenting with DKA, and also evaluate children with DKA and acute COVID-19 infection. Methods This is a retrospective multi-center study among 997 children and adolescents with type 1 diabetes who were admitted with DKA to 27 pediatric intensive care units in Turkey between the first year of pandemic and pre-pandemic year. Results The percentage of children with new-onset Type 1 diabetes presenting with DKA was higher during the COVID-19 pandemic (p < 0.0001). The incidence of severe DKA was also higher during the COVID-19 pandemic (p < 0.0001) and also higher among children with new onset Type 1 diabetes (p < 0.0001). HbA1c levels, duration of insulin infusion, and length of PICU stay were significantly higher/longer during the pandemic period. Eleven patients tested positive for SARS-CoV-2, eight were positive for new onset Type 1 diabetes, and nine tested positive for severe DKA at admission. Discussion The frequency of new onset of Type 1 diabetes and severe cases among children with DKA during the first year of the COVID-19 pandemic. Furthermore, the cause of the increased severe presentation might be related to restrictions related to the pandemic;however, need to evaluate the potential effects of SARS-CoV-2 on the increased percentage of new onset Type 1 diabetes.
